I am looking to purchase the D1 Airs. I have Alien Bees so I am used to them. I have read the Profoto website and BH but still not certain on the questions below?

Do they have a built in optical slave? It says IR but not sure what it means.

Can I use my Vagabond II with them?

Is the Air unit proprietary or can other transmitters fire them?

Due to cost I am going to use Photoflex Octodomes. Is this a waste of money to use Photoflex modifiers with Profoto lights? I don't want to spend $1000 on a softbox!

Hi Lonnie,

Yes Profoto could be triggered as optical slave.

Yes you could use Vagabone II but the recycle time will be damn slow. Plus PCB himself suggests only use Vagabone II on AB/WL because of the liability reason.

No. One could trigger its own system.

Softbox/beauty dish vs. light, I would spend more money on the better light modifier first. I mean unless you are using bare bulb, which no softbox needed, the quality of the light hits on subject really depends on what and how it reflects on (or/and goes through) the softbox material. For same amount of money, I would rather stay with AB/WL and get better softbox or beauty dish. Same reason why people were encouraged to get better lens before they get better camera body.

Thanks Ming. I didn't see this earlier so I called B&H and they said the same things. The Profoto wireless system will only fire the built in receivers and they have optical/IR slaves. They have a 1/8 plug so I could use different witless triggers if I have to but it would defeat the purpose because the Profoto Air system not only triggers but gives you full control if all the light settings including turning them on and off. I didn't ask about the Vagabond or softboxes. On another note AB, CL, Elinchrom and Profoto only have silver lining octos. Photoflex is the only brand that I have seen with white interior.
